Conditions We Manage
With a child-centred approach, we address both common and complex paediatric conditions, from initial diagnosis to ongoing care:
- Common infections (respiratory, gastrointestinal, urinary, skin)
Management of frequent childhood infections with appropriate medication and supportive care.
- Asthma and allergic disorders
Individualised treatment for asthma, allergic rhinitis, eczema, and food allergies, including inhaler training and trigger control.
- Nutritional deficiencies and anaemia
Assessment and correction of poor weight gain, vitamin deficiencies, and iron-deficiency anaemia with dietary guidance and supplementation.
- Growth and developmental delays
Early identification and intervention for children with delayed growth or developmental milestones, with specialist referrals as needed.
- Febrile seizures and neurological concerns
Comprehensive care for febrile seizures, epilepsy, and other neurological conditions with ongoing monitoring and parental support.
- Congenital and genetic disorders
Multidisciplinary support for children with birth defects or inherited conditions, including genetic counselling and long-term care planning.
- Childhood obesity and metabolic conditions
Holistic management of obesity and related metabolic issues, with a focus on sustainable lifestyle changes.
- Childhood diabetes and endocrine disorders
Ongoing management of diabetes, thyroid issues, and growth concerns with family-focused education and treatment.
- Paediatric emergencies and injuries
Prompt care for common emergencies such as trauma, dehydration, seizures, and poisoning.
- Behavioural and learning difficulties
Support for children with ADHD, autism, and learning disorders through assessments and specialist coordination.
